WebMay 24, 2024 · #3 – Terraces. Terraces are houses built as part of a continuous row in a uniform style. In simple term, terraced houses are connected by a single wall on either side, leading to a row of houses. A terrace can come either in bungalows or duplexes, but terraced duplexes are common in this part of the world.
